Frequently Asked Questions
How do I handle the curves of the tank during installation?
When applying decals to compound curves, using a heat gun on a low setting helps the vinyl conform perfectly without wrinkling. Keep the heat source moving and maintain a safe distance. Applying gentle heat after the decal is in place ensures the adhesive sets correctly against the unique shape of the panel.
How do I determine the correct side for placement?
In the motorcycle industry, the left and right sides are always determined from the rider's seated position. The right side corresponds to the throttle grip, while the left side corresponds to the clutch lever. This standardized system is used across all official manufacturer parts catalogs to ensure accurate component selection.
Ensure the surface is completely stripped of all wax and oils using isopropyl alcohol before applying the emblem to ensure a permanent adhesive bond.
